Transaction

d4f81aa8a8bd907ba8e2b0ae100820de98e5a10cada359cbc1fa7416478dd7e3
442,890 confirmations
Timestamp
1512514947
Block497,807
Fee607,082 sats
Fee rate103.3 sats/vB
view on mempool.space

Inputs & Outputs

Inputs